Not a bad first stab, just a few pointers to things you may not have
thought of, or thought through.

>1) Hierarchy of bones:
> a) Back / Neck

Well that won't do for a start. The seven cervical vertebrae must
count mush higher, then the 12 thoracic then the other seven,
> b) Femur

You missed the Pelvis, probably even more serious than the Femur in
terms of mortality, with a huge risk of bleeding out if it's badly
broken.

> c) Tibia / Fibula
> d) Scapula
> e) Humerus
> f) Radius/Ulna
> g) Scaphoid
> h) Collar bone

Naa, the collar bone's a doddle. Painful, sure, and restrictive, but
not really dangerous either in the short- or the long-term

> i) ribs

As previously mentioned, ribs should be much higher, right after Femur
IMO, mitigated by your seriousness factors below.

> j) finger/toes (and other small bones in feet and hands- extra points if digits lost)
> k) nose/cheek bones (extra points if cheek bone and helmet used to ride bike to hospital)

>
>2) Hierarchy of type of break
> a) Compound
> b) Displaced
> c) Simple fracture

Some leeway for 'special' breaks, like the vertebrae with their
interlinking "notches". I broke 9 in my big smash, but only 3 of them
were so badly crushed that they were in imminent danger of
displacement wrt each other, and therefore needed to be fused together
and pinned.

>3) Duration of hospital stay

+Duration in intensive care, more important.

>4) Number of surgical procedures

And severity. half-hour jobs under a local to remove a couple of pins
in the hand can't compare with four hours under the knife having a
smashed femur pieced back together.

>5) Additional factors for treatment by traction

Why? (presumably because you had it and want it to count higher). In
any case it's something that's rarely used these days, used to be much
more common before pinning and plating become the norm for serious
fractures.

>> I broke several (never got told how many) highsiding the Tiger, with a
>> concomitant punctured lung. In A&E, the consultant asked if it was OK if
>> he showed his trainee how to put in a drain, and I said yes. "First,
>> local anaesthetic" (needle prick) "Then we make the incision,
>> positioning it between these ribs" (no, didn't feel that). "Next, we
>> separate the ribs slightly" (AAARGH AAAARGH Fucking hell sorry about the
>> swearing) "Like this?" (AAARGH again) "And then we insert the drain" (OW
>> OW OW). Then they experimented with a mixture of morphine and ketamine
>> on me. All in all, an eventful day.
>
> I was unaware of the first drain being inserted, as I was so heavily
> drugged up that I might as well have been under a General Anaesthetic.
> Roll on a week in intensive care, they finally realise that the other
> lung is also collapsed, for how long wasn't clear, although I'd been
> complaining for days about the pressure building in the abdominal
> cavity. So this time they put the drain in as you described; the
> incision was not too bad, although ISTR there were scissors involved,
> nit just a scalpel, but the final entry was possibly the most painful
> thing I've ever experienced in my life. Nothing could have prepared me
> for it.
>
> The doctor wasn't prepared either, for the torrent of bloody fluids
> that spurted out, liberally covering him and much of the room, and I
> suspect the release of pressure was a significant factor in the pain
> levels.
>
I'm still recuperating from surgery a few months ago. When they brought
me out of the surgery, they put me on another bed and I spent the night
there. That bed had an automatic machine that raised and lowered the
lower torso every few minutes to alleviate blood clotting. But I'd had
surgery a few years ago for a ruptured disc in my lower back, so every
time the bed shifted, it sent agonizing pains through my back. "Sorry,
sir, this is the only bed we have and there's no way to turn it off."
FARK.

I've been down a bunch of times, but the most dramatic was in 1980 when
a guy ran me down intentionally on the motorway at 60mph. I was wearing
sandals, a jumper and an open-face helmet. I went flying, hit the
cement, did a tuck and roll. The glass popped out of my spectacles and
the wire frames went in around my eyeballs, destroying my tear ducts. At
the time, it seemed really minor, but all the broken bones and scraped
skin healed fairly rapidly. Now, the tear duct issue is what may end my
riding career.
